What Is Ysense?

Ysense is a get-paid-to website that pays users for completing small tasks such as paid surveys and paid offers.

It’s been around since 2007 and was known as Clixsense until it rebranded to Ysense in 2019.

Ysense is owned by Prodege, the same company behind Swagbucks, Inbox Dollars, MyPoints, and other well-known earning platforms.

With an active forum and global community of daily users, Ysense has become a very popular GPT platform.

Is Ysense Legit?

Ysense has been operating since 2007 and has a large, global community of users.

It’s owned by Prodege, a well-known company in the GPT and market research industry.

Ysense does pay its users, and payments are usually processed fairly quickly.

However, earnings are low as with all GPT platforms, some surveys will disqualify you, and some paid offers require personal information.

Ysense is a legitimate platform, you just need to use it with the right expectations and only expect some extra cash from it.

Ways To Earn On Ysense

There are many different ways to earn on Ysense including surveys, paid offers, and playing games.

It’s best to choose the options that you like best to make sure you can complete the tasks you start.

Here’s an overview of all the ways to earn on Ysense:

Paid Surveys

Paid surveys are one of the most popular ways to earn on Ysense. There are many surveys available but be aware the amount available will vary depending on your country.

The surveys pay decently starting from around $0.10 up to $3 -$4.

Sometimes there are also high paying surveys available that pay from $5-$10, but these opportunities are rare.

The paid surveys are a decent way to earn some extra cash on Ysense, especially if you live in a country that has a lot of surveys available.

Paid Offers

Ysense has many paid offers you can complete. It has 4 offerwalls to choose from, its own offerwall and three third-party ones.

Some of the offers are unique to Ysense, but they still work the same way.

For the paid offers you’ll have to spend some time on them. It will require you to do something like download an app and use it, sign up for a free trial, make a purchase or something else similar.

They pay anywhere from $1 up to $100+ depending on the offer and how long it takes to complete.

The paid offers will take time to complete but they are worth doing if you are interested in them, and they are a great way to earn extra money.

Playing Games

You can also earn by playing games on your phone. You’ll need to download the game you want and complete levels or other required tasks.

These tasks do take a long time to complete but they pay very well if you do finish them.

Some of the games can pay hundreds of dollars but will take you many days or even weeks to complete.

If you like playing games and want to make some extra, playing games on Ysense is definitely worth it and you can earn some really decent extra cash.

Watching Videos

Ysense has an option to earn by watching videos.

Keep in mind, this option is only available in certain countries, so if you can’t find it, that means it’s not available for you.

They pay you for watching the videos and viewing the ads that appear.

You will earn after watching around 7 to 10 videos. But you’ll only earn $0.02 to $0.03 for every batch you watch.

This is not worth it in my opinion. Although it’s higher than other GPT websites that offer this earning method, you won’t earn much and are better off doing the surveys and paid offers where you will earn much faster.

Shopping & Cashback Offers

Ysense features some shopping and cashback offers. However, they’re not from major brands or popular platforms.

They are found in some of the offerwalls, but you do need to look around for them.

There are limited offers available compared to other GPT platforms, but you can make some extra money if you buy something or join a program through one of these offers.

Daily Poll & Weekly Bonuses

There’s also a daily poll on Ysense where you have to answer 1 short question and you will earn $0.01.

This is only available once per day but it’s still something extra to boost your earnings.

You’ll also get a daily checklist of small goals to complete such as complete two surveys or offers.

You’ll earn a small bonus for completing your daily checklist, and if you do it every day, you’ll earn extra bonuses throughout the week.

The bonuses you earn this way are only small but stack up over time. So, it’s worth paying attention if you’re very active on Ysense.

Referral Program

Ysense has a referral program where you can earn money by referring people to Ysense.

When someone joins through your referral link, you’ll earn a small bonus and also 10% commissions on all your referrals earnings for life.

Please note, this won’t affect your referrals earnings in any way, as it’s just a bonus you get for referring them to the platform.

If you promote Ysense and get a good number of active referrals, you can earn some really good money with this method.

Payout Options On Ysense

Ysense has a wide range of payout options, and you can get paid no matter where you live.

The payout options available to you will depend on your country, but there’s something for everyone.

You can choose from PayPal, Payoneer, Skrill and a wide range of gift cards like Amazon, Caltex, iTunes and more.

The payout threshold is a bit higher on Ysense than on other GPT platforms, but it still shouldn’t take you too long to reach.

You can cashout anytime once you reach the payout threshold for your chosen payment method.

Payouts are usually processed within 3 to 5 business days and may sometimes require identity verification to prevent fraud.

Overall, Ysense offers some reliable payout options, and cashing out is simple once you’ve reached the payout threshold.

How Much Can You Make On Ysense?

Ysense is a good platform to earn some extra cash. But it won’t make you rich or provide you with a full-time income.

Most people earn $1 to $5 per day, but it’s not the same for everyone.

The amount you earn will vary depending on your country, the tasks available and how much time you spend completing tasks.

The types of tasks you do also matter. Surveys pay low, paid offers pay higher but involve more work, and games pay really well but take a long time to complete.

You’ll earn more if you log in consistently and complete tasks. Don’t forget to collect your bonuses each day to boost your earnings.

If you have a bunch of active referrals, you’ll also earn more each month. But you shouldn’t expect any huge earnings from the platform.

Overall, Ysense won’t make you rich, but it’s a reliable way to earn some extra cash if you use it consistently.
